Local villagers on Wednesday protested inside the Mahagun Modern society in Noida's Sector 78 against the alleged beating up of a domestic help by one of the residents.
The protestors alleged that the help was held captive at the employer's residence.
However, the residents of the society rubbished all the allegations and said the house help had concocted the whole incident and created an unwarranted outrage, while adding that the protest by the local villagers was uncalled for.
"The woman is lying. She was totally fine when she left the society. The mob unnecessarily gathered and pelted stones at us. The unruly behaviour was illegitimate," said Ashish Gupta, a resident of the society.
"We have her in our CCTV footage. She was absolutely fine when she left. All her allegations are false," said another resident Puneet Kumar.
According to reports, the protestors flooded the society early morning today and created chaos.
The police has been deployed outside the apartment after the incident and is trying to bring the situation under control.
Domestic help Zohra was missing for a day following a fight with her employer.
